“ The value of a principle is the number of things it will explain. ”

Meaning

This quote means the worth of a principle is shown by how much reality it can help make sense of.

Ralph Waldo Emerson was an American essayist, philosopher, and poet, known for his work on transcendentalism and individualism. His quotes often reflect self-reliance, wisdom, and introspection. Emerson inspires writers, thinkers, and students to embrace personal growth, independent thought, and the philosophical exploration of life and nature.
